Nuclear Power Stations utilise a fuel called uranium, a comparatively common material. Energy is freed from uranium when an atom is split by a neutron. The uranium atom is split up into 2 and as this occurs energy is released as radiation and heat.This nuclear reaction is known as the fission process In a nuclear power station the uranium is first formed into pellets and then into long rods. |
